Title :
Beyond turbo codes: Rate-compatible punctured polar codes
Author :
Kai Niu ; Kai Chen ; Jia-Ru Lin
Author_Institution :
Key Lab. of Universal Wireless Commun., Beijing Univ. of Posts & Telecommun., Beijing, China
Abstract :
CRC (cyclic redundancy check) concatenated polar codes are superior to the turbo codes under the successive cancellation list (SCL) or successive cancellation stack (SCS) decoding algorithms. But the code length of polar codes is limited to the power of two. In this paper, a family of rate-compatible punctured polar (RCPP) codes is proposed to satisfy the construction with arbitrary code length. We propose a simple quasi-uniform puncturing algorithm to generate the puncturing table. And we prove that this method has better row-weight property than that of the random puncturing. Simulation results under the binary input additive white Gaussian noise channels (BI-AWGNs) show that these RCPP codes outperform the performance of turbo codes in WCDMA (Wideband Code Division Multiple Access) or LTE (Long Term Evolution) wireless communication systems in the large range of code lengths. Especially, the RCPP code with CRC-aided SCL/SCS algorithm can provide over 0.7dB performance gain at the block error rate (BLER) of 10-4 with short code length M = 512 and code rate R = 0.5.
Keywords :
AWGN channels; concatenated codes; decoding; error statistics; turbo codes; BI-AWGN; BLER; CRC concatenated codes; LTE; Long Term Evolution; RCPP codes; SCL decoding algorithms; SCS decoding algorithms; WCDMA; arbitrary code length; binary input additive white Gaussian noise channels; block error rate; cyclic redundancy check codes; puncturing table; quasi-uniform puncturing algorithm; random puncturing; rate-compatible punctured polar codes; row-weight property; successive cancellation list decoding algorithms; successive cancellation stack decoding algorithms; turbo codes; wideband code division multiple access; wireless communication systems; Decoding; Generators; Multiaccess communication; Spread spectrum communication; Turbo codes; Vectors;
Conference_Titel :
Communications (ICC), 2013 IEEE International Conference on
Conference_Location :
Budapest
DOI :
10.1109/ICC.2013.6655078